Open Source & Free

Your Dev Services,
One Dashboard.

Manage, monitor, and orchestrate all your local development services from one beautiful dashboard. Real-time metrics, auto-restart, smart port handling.

DevDock
DevDock Dashboard with active services

Everything you need to manage local services

DevDock gives you a complete toolkit for managing your development environment.

Real-time Monitoring

Live CPU & memory charts for every service. See resource usage trends with animated Recharts visualizations.

Service Management

Start, stop, and restart services with one click. Manage all your local dev processes from a single dashboard.

Smart Port Handling

Auto-detects port conflicts and reassigns ports automatically. No more 'port already in use' headaches.

Auto-Restart

Crashed services restart automatically with exponential backoff. Your dev environment stays running smoothly.

Unified Logs

All service logs in one searchable, color-coded view. Filter by service, search by keyword, auto-scroll to latest.

Cross-Platform

Works on Windows, macOS, and Linux. Available as .exe, .dmg, .AppImage, and .deb packages.

Get started in minutes

Three simple steps to a better dev workflow.

01

Install

Download the DevDock binary for your operating system, or build from source with npm.

02

Add Services

Configure your local dev services - name, command, working directory, port, and restart behavior.

03

Monitor

Start all services and watch real-time CPU, memory, and status charts on your dashboard.

See it in action

Services

Services

Manage all your dev services

Logs

Logs

Unified log viewer for all services

Settings

Settings

Configure DevDock to your liking

Dashboard (Idle)

Dashboard (Idle)

Dashboard ready for your services

Services (Empty)

Services (Empty)

Clean start - add your first service

Logs (Empty)

Logs (Empty)

Logs appear as services run

Ready to streamline your workflow?

Download DevDock for free and start managing your services today.

Or view all releases on GitHub